## Sensor drift: what to do at 3am

If the GrowLoop controller starts reporting humidity swings that don't match the backup probes in the Fernwick greenhouse, it's almost always sensor drift, not an actual climate event. Don't panic and don't touch the vents manually. First, restart the calibration daemon and give it ten minutes to re-baseline. If readings still disagree by more than 5%, flip the controller into safe mode. The safe-mode thresholds it will use are these.

config for yahap-bajof:
[istix]
host = istix.qorvelsys.internal
user = istix_svc
database = istix_prod

Postmortem timeline — Fernwick public API pagination incident. 09:12 — cursor tokens began repeating after the sharding migration. 09:26 — clients reported infinite loops fetching page two. 09:40 — pagination endpoint rate-limited as mitigation. 10:05 — cursor encoding patched to include shard ID. 10:30 — full recovery confirmed. Maintainers: the patched deploy is traceable via the token below.

pipeline stamp: htk9_ce63042d9

Subject: DR drill recap — FD leak hunt on Parchfield gateway

For future maintainers: during last week's disaster-recovery drill we confirmed the gateway exhausts file descriptors under sustained failover traffic. Root cause was unclosed sockets in the retry path; patch is merged. The drill also exercised the sealed diagnostics archive, which holds the lsof captures. Opening that archive requires the recovery passphrase, which for the record is included below.

recovery phrase for kagef-bagaf: kelath-raleth-casion-rusvan-novvan-aldath-eliael-holael-julox-tamys-joreth-praion-druix-pelys

Subject: Inkwell markdown pipeline 5.1 deployed

On-call: the Inkwell rendering pipeline is now on 5.1 in production. Changes: sanitizer runs before the table parser, footnote rendering is cached per document, and the fallback plain-text path no longer strips headings. If render latency alarms fire, roll back via the standard script — it handles cache invalidation. Known issue: nested blockquotes over six levels render flat. The deployment trace token follows.

build token for hawep-kageg: htk14_558814e2114cc7